dns exe

DNS(域名系统)是互联网基础设施的核心组成部分,它将人类可读的域名(如www.example.com)转换为机器可读的IP地址(如93.184.216.34),从而实现网络资源的访问,在Windows操作系统中,DNS相关的功能通常由系统服务或命令行工具管理,而“dns.exe”则是其中较为特殊的可执行文件,本文将围绕dns.exe的功能、使用场景、潜在风险及安全注意事项展开,帮助用户全面了解这一工具。

dns exe

dns.exe的基本

dns.exe是Windows操作系统中的一个命令行工具,通常位于系统目录(如C:WindowsSystem32)下,它属于DNS客户端工具的一部分,主要用于查询和管理DNS记录,与图形化界面工具相比,dns.exe更适合高级用户或脚本化操作,能够快速获取DNS解析信息或排查网络问题,需要注意的是,dns.exe并非系统核心进程,其功能可部分通过“nslookup”或“dig”等工具替代,但它在某些特定场景下仍具有不可替代的作用。

dns.exe的主要功能

dns.exe的核心功能是执行DNS查询操作,通过命令行参数,用户可以查询域名对应的IP地址、反向解析IP对应的域名、检查DNS记录的TTL(生存时间)等,使用“dns.exe example.com”命令可直接获取域名的A记录;结合“-type”参数,还能查询MX(邮件交换记录)、NS(名称服务器记录)等其他类型的DNS记录,dns.exe支持递归查询和迭代查询,帮助用户分析DNS解析路径中的问题。

使用dns.exe的常见场景

  1. 网络故障排查:当网站无法访问时,可通过dns.exe检查域名是否正确解析到IP地址,确认是否为DNS配置问题。
  2. 域名管理验证:管理员在修改DNS记录后,可使用dns.exe验证新记录是否生效,确保域名解析符合预期。
  3. 脚本化自动化:在批处理脚本或PowerShell中调用dns.exe,可实现DNS查询的自动化,适用于大规模网络监控或日志分析。

dns.exe的命令行参数详解

dns.exe的功能丰富,主要依赖于不同的命令行参数:

  • -query:指定要查询的域名,如“dns.exe -query www.example.com”。
  • -type:设置查询的记录类型,如“A”“MX”“TXT”等。
  • -server:指定DNS服务器地址,用于测试特定DNS服务器的解析结果。
  • -verbose:显示详细的查询过程,便于分析DNS解析路径。

命令“dns.exe -query example.com -type MX -server 8.8.8.8”将使用Google的DNS服务器查询example.com的MX记录。

dns exe

潜在风险与安全注意事项

尽管dns.exe是系统自带工具,但恶意软件可能伪装成dns.exe进行非法操作,用户需注意以下几点:

  1. 文件来源验证:确保dns.exe位于系统目录,且文件哈希值与官方发布的一致。
  2. 权限控制:避免以管理员权限运行可疑的dns.exe,防止恶意代码篡改系统设置。
  3. 网络环境安全:在公共网络中使用dns.exe时,避免查询敏感域名,防止信息泄露。

替代工具对比

dns.exe并非唯一的DNS查询工具,以下为常见替代方案:

  • nslookup:Windows内置的交互式DNS查询工具,功能类似但更易上手。
  • dig:Linux/macOS下的常用工具,功能更强大,支持更多DNS记录类型。
  • Resolve-DnsName:PowerShell模块中的 cmdlet,适合Windows管理员进行集成化管理。

用户可根据需求选择合适的工具,dns.exe的优势在于其轻量化和命令行灵活性。

dns.exe作为Windows系统中的DNS查询工具,在特定场景下能够高效完成域名解析任务,尽管其功能可被其他工具部分替代,但对于需要命令行操作或脚本集成的用户而言,dns.exe仍具有实用价值,使用时需注意文件安全性,并结合实际需求选择合适的工具,以确保网络管理的便捷与安全。

dns exe


FAQs

Q1: dns.exe与nslookup有何区别?
A1: dns.exe和nslookup均用于DNS查询,但dns.exe更注重命令行参数的灵活性,适合脚本化操作;而nslookup提供交互式界面,支持更复杂的查询流程,适合即时调试,dns.exe的输出格式更简洁,便于程序解析。

Q2: 如何确认系统中的dns.exe是否为正版?
A2: 可通过以下步骤验证:

  1. 检查文件路径是否为“C:WindowsSystem32dns.exe”;
  2. 右键点击文件选择“属性”,查看“数字签名”选项卡,确认签名者是否为“Microsoft Corporation”;
  3. 使用工具(如 certutil)计算文件哈希值,并与微软官方提供的哈希值对比,若发现异常,建议立即通过系统文件检查器(sfc /scannow)修复。

来源互联网整合,作者:小编,如若转载,请注明出处:https://www.aiboce.com/ask/300299.html

Like (0)
小编小编
Previous 2025年12月4日 19:40
Next 2025年12月4日 19:49

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注